Strike Fear Into The guts of Nobody With The PlayStation Move Sharp Shooter [Games]

Strike Fear Into The guts of Nobody With The PlayStation Move Sharp Shooter [Games] Maybe if this PlayStation Move gun came in black it’d be a touch more manly. But in white, with the Move’s colored globe poking out of the tip, it’s as frightening as having a custard donut waved at you.

Designed to aid make Killzone 3 more of an interactive, active, really-like-shooting-someone experience, it launches alongside the game next February for $39.99. And there’s also a ” Jungle Green” DUALSHOCK 3 coming in addition, in the event you prefer commanding from a more authoritative and dignified seated position. [ PS Blog via Kotaku ]
